PostgreSQL 模糊查询优化(全模糊、忽略大小写优化)

PostgreSQL 模糊查询优化(全模糊、忽略大小写优化) 模糊查询是数据库系统中非常常见的一种操作,比如查找用户名、邮件、用户地址、电话等等。我们知道前缀匹配(LIKE xx%)是可以走索引的,但是全模糊(LIKE %xx%)就无法走索引,甚至忽略大小写等这些需求给数据查询带来非常大的挑战。 今

K8s常用命令

K8s常用命令 集群管理 1. 查看集群节点状态: kubectl get nodes 2. 查看集群资源使用情况(需要安装metric-server): kubectl top nodes 3. 查看集群信息: kubectl cluster-info 4. 获取节点详细信息: kubect

PostgreSQL WAL机制与重放流程详解

PostgreSQL WAL机制与重放流程详解 PostgreSQL的WAL(Write-Ahead Logging)机制是数据库可靠性和容灾能力的核心。本文将详细介绍 WAL 的基本原理、重放机制(Replay)、归档策略(Archiving)以及相关使用场景。 一、什么是 WAL? WAL 是

Linux中xargs 命令详解与实用场景

Linux中xargs 命令详解与实用场景 xargs 是 Linux/Unix 系统中常用的命令行工具之一,它能够从标准输入构造参数列表并传递给其他命令使用,是处理批量数据操作时的重要利器。 一、xargs 的基本语法 xargs [OPTION]... [COMMAND [INITIAL-ARG

Linux 

Linux Shell 中的命令连接符:`&&`、`||`、`;` 的用法详解与实战场景

Linux Shell 中的命令连接符:&&、||、; 的用法详解与实战场景 在日常的 Linux 运维工作中,Shell 脚本和命令行操作是基础中的基础。而在命令行中合理地使用命令连接符 &&、|| 和 ;,不仅可以提高效率,还能构建出更健壮的自动化流程。本文将从概念、语法到实际案例,系统讲解这三

Linux 

AI 入门与掌握 Roadmap

AI 入门与掌握 Roadmap 第一阶段:基础知识铺垫(1-2 个月) 数学基础 线性代数(矩阵、向量、特征值分解) 概率统计(贝叶斯定理、期望、方差、概率分布) 微积分(偏导数、梯度、链式法则) 编程基础 Python(NumPy, Pandas, Matplotlib, Scikit-lear

AI 

Golang 反射Reflect实践

Golang 反射(Reflection)实践 1. 引言 在 Golang 语言中,反射(Reflection)提供了一种在运行时检查变量类型、调用方法或访问结构体字段的能力。反射的核心在于 reflect 包,它提供了 reflect.Type 和 reflect.Value 这两个关键类型来解

Golang 

深入浅出DNS

深入浅出DNS 什么是DNS 概念 DNS(Domain Name System)是一个分布式分级管理的数据库。他存储的是hostname与IP的对应关系、邮件路由信息以及其他互联网应用数据等等。 Domain Name 说到DNS就离不开域名(Domain Name),因为DNS主要解析以及存储的

扬帆 起航

别在树下徘徊,别在雨中沉思,别在黑暗中落泪,向前看,不要回头,只要你勇于面对抬起头来,就会发现,此时的阴霾不过是短暂的雨季,向前看,还有一片明亮的天,不会使人感到彷徨。——莎士比亚 ​​​